  Contecon Guayaquil (CGSA), International Container Terminal Services, Inc.’s (ICTSI) Ecuadorian business unit operating the multipurpose terminal in the Port of Guayaquil, has set a new industry benchmark by achieving an average truck turnaround time of less than 27 minutes.
